SIDOXIA'S STORY

SIDOXIA'S STORY

The greatest leaders and innovations in history have been created with the help of optimism. Our firm name, Sidoxia, is inspired by the Greek word for optimism. For every problem there is a corresponding opportunity and solution. Sidoxia was established to fill a void in the financial services marketplace for independent, client-driven advice that is free of conflicts.


Sidoxia was founded by Wade W. Slome, CFA®, CFP® in 2008 in Newport Beach, California. Having managed a $20 billion mutual fund and worked in the industry for more than thirty years, Mr. Slome’s extensive experience and credentials allow him to provide institutional-quality service to all clients.


The optimistic theme underlying Sidoxia’s name also stems from Mr. Slome’s older brother, who earned an academic award for being the “Most Optimistic” before he succumbed to complications related to his mental illness.
